The paper considers the results of an adaptive predictive control system implemented in a combustion furnace. The main goal is to optimize the temperature control replacing the existing PID. The furnace dynamic is strongly nonlinear, has an important delay and its behavior depends on the operating point. These characteristics make the system very attractive for implementing a controller that achieves a more precise temperature control. The application consists of a weighted predictive control with its parameters obtained indirectly from a recursive identification of the plant. The project was developed at Siderca - Argentina, a seamless steel pipe factory. Copyright (C) 1998 IFAC.
